GGE4313Photogrammetry4 ch (3C 2L)

Photogrammetric principles, systems, sensors, and products. Geometry of vertical, tilted and stereoscopic aerial photographs. Fundamental photo and model space coordinate systems. Photogrammetric measurement and refinement. Direct and inverse coordinate transformations. Collinearity and coplanarity conditions, direct linear transformation and rational function models. Interior and exterior orientations. Concepts of aero-triangulation. Principles of images matching and epipolar geometry, DEM generation and orthorectification. Close range and UAV photogrammetry, Flight project planning. Integration of LiDAR and Photogrammetry.

Prerequisites: GGE 3342 and GGE 3111.
